CISO(A&S) Integration into Office of the Deputy Assistant Secretary of Defense for Industrial Policy, DoD

FEB. 17, 2021 | Announcement

In order to improve integration and promote the security of Defense Industrial Base (DIB) activities within the purview of the Office of the Under Secretary of Defense for Acquisition and Sustainment (OUSD(A&S)), the Office of the Chief Information Security Officer for Acquisition and Sustainment (CISO(A&S)) was integrated into the Office of the Deputy Assistant Secretary of Defense for Industrial Policy on January 19, 2021. CISO(A&S) will continue to be responsible for cyber and information security efforts within the entire OUSD(A&S) portfolio, to include the Cybersecurity Maturity Model Certification program, Trusted Capital program, Supply Chain Risk Management program, and various cybersecurity programs and requirements set forth in the National Defense Authorization Act for FY 2021.

CISO(A&S), led by Ms. Katie Arrington, will be the A&S representative for DIB cyber and information security, as well as the Department of Defense representative to the Federal Acquisition Security Council. The team will continue to oversee planning, coordination, synchronization, and integration of cybersecurity in weapon systems, defense critical infrastructure, and the DIB. This realignment will build on existing synergy, relationships, and strong organizational structures, and we believe all offices will benefit from increased coordination and sharing of analytic and administrative functions.
